Home
last modified time | relevance | path

Searched refs:remote_i_size (Results 1 – 3 of 3) sorted by relevance

/linux/include/linux/
H A Dnetfs.h495 unsigned long long remote_i_size; in netfs_read_remote_i_size() local
502 remote_i_size = ictx->_remote_i_size; in netfs_read_remote_i_size()
506 remote_i_size = ictx->_remote_i_size; in netfs_read_remote_i_size()
510 remote_i_size = smp_load_acquire(&ictx->_remote_i_size); in netfs_read_remote_i_size()
512 return remote_i_size; in netfs_read_remote_i_size()
530 unsigned long long remote_i_size) in netfs_write_remote_i_size() argument
536 ictx->_remote_i_size = remote_i_size; in netfs_write_remote_i_size()
540 ictx->_remote_i_size = remote_i_size; in netfs_write_remote_i_size()
548 smp_store_release(&ictx->_remote_i_size, remote_i_size); in netfs_write_remote_i_size()
647 unsigned long long *remote_i_size, in netfs_read_sizes() argument
[all …]
/linux/fs/netfs/
H A Dmisc.c221 unsigned long long i_size, remote_i_size, zero_point; in netfs_invalidate_folio() local
224 netfs_read_sizes(inode, &i_size, &remote_i_size, &zero_point); in netfs_invalidate_folio()
308 unsigned long long i_size, remote_i_size, zero_point, end; in netfs_release_folio() local
313 netfs_read_sizes(inode, &i_size, &remote_i_size, &zero_point); in netfs_release_folio()
/linux/fs/smb/client/
H A Dsmb2ops.c3405 unsigned long long i_size, new_size, remote_i_size, zero_point; in smb3_zero_range() local
3416 netfs_read_sizes(inode, &i_size, &remote_i_size, &zero_point); in smb3_zero_range()
3417 if (offset + len >= remote_i_size && offset < i_size) { in smb3_zero_range()
3477 unsigned long long end = offset + len, i_size, remote_i_size, zero_point; in smb3_punch_hole() local
3519 netfs_read_sizes(inode, &i_size, &remote_i_size, &zero_point); in smb3_punch_hole()
3521 if (end > remote_i_size && i_size > remote_i_size) { in smb3_punch_hole()